This role is for one of the Weekday's clients Min Experience: 8 years Location: United States JobType: full-time We are seeking an experienced and dynamic Flink Leader to drive the design, development, and delivery of large-scale real-time data processing solutions.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in Apache Flink, strong Java programming skills, and proven leadership experience managing high-performing engineering teams. This role requires a strategic thinker who can lead complex streaming data initiatives while collaborating closely with cross-functional stakeholders to deliver scalable, reliable, and high-performance solutions. As a Flink Leader, you will play a critical role in architecting next-generation streaming platforms and enabling real-time analytics capabilities for enterprise-scale applications. You will mentor engineers, define technical roadmaps, establish best practices, and ensure the successful execution of data engineering projects. Key Responsibilities Lead the architecture, development, and optimization of real-time streaming applications using Apache Flink. Design scalable and fault-tolerant distributed systems capable of handling high-volume data streams. Manage and mentor engineering teams, ensuring technical excellence, collaboration, and continuous learning. Drive end-to-end project delivery including requirement analysis, solution design, development, deployment, and production support. Collaborate with product managers, architects, DevOps teams, and business stakeholders to define technical solutions aligned with organizational goals. Develop robust applications and services using Java and modern backend engineering practices. Implement data processing pipelines, stream analytics, event-driven architectures, and real-time monitoring solutions. Ensure system reliability, scalability, performance tuning, and operational efficiency across distributed environments. Establish coding standards, review code quality, and promote engineering best practices. Lead troubleshooting and root-cause analysis for production issues in streaming and distributed systems. Contribute to technology strategy, innovation initiatives, and continuous platform improvements. Support hiring, team building, and capability development for streaming data engineering teams. Required Skills Strong hands-on expertise in Apache Flink and stream processing architectures. Excellent programming experience in Java with strong understanding of multithreading, concurrency, and distributed systems. Proven experience leading engineering teams and managing large-scale technical programs. Strong knowledge of real-time data processing, event streaming, and microservices architecture. Experience with distributed messaging systems such as Kafka. Understanding of big data ecosystems and cloud-native technologies. Expertise in performance optimization, scalability, and high-availability system design. Strong problem-solving, stakeholder management, and communication skills. Experience working in Agile and fast-paced engineering environments. Good to Have Skills Experience with Spark, Hadoop, or other big data technologies. Exposure to c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or GCP. Knowledge of containerization and orchestration tools like Docker and Kubernetes. Experience with C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ices. Familiarity with monitoring and observability tools. Experience & Qualifications 8 to 18 years of overall IT experience with significant expertise in data engineering and streaming technologies.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field. Demonstrated experience leading enterprise-scale real-time data platform implementations.
